Chrysler Corp committing warranty fraud
Apr 11, 2008
Chrysler Corporation complaint by Lauraw0521
I have a 2004 Dodge Intrepid I purchase with appr 26000.00 miles for around 20,000.00 The car currently had 68000.00 miles and has been in the shop since 1/2. I was recently told the engine a 2.7V6 is covered in sludge and needs replaced at a cost of around 8000.00. Chrysler denied my warranty stating I failed to maintain the vehicle even though I have receipts for every oil change done-all at 3000 miles. When trying to contact Chrysler I'm simply told the decision stands.I did some research on the engine and have found the engine is faulty and Chrysler knows the issue and the company is refusing all warranties. I refuse to be a victim and have found many consumers who are willing to join a class action lawsuit.
